OKX挂单攻略:解锁交易技巧,抓住加密货币机遇!

时间:2025-03-06 阅读数:47人阅读

OKX 的挂单策略分析

在加密货币交易中,挂单策略是一种常见的交易方法,允许交易者提前设置买入或卖出订单,并在达到特定价格时自动执行。OKX 作为领先的加密货币交易所,提供了多种挂单类型,以满足不同交易者的需求。理解和掌握 OKX 的挂单策略,对于提高交易效率、控制风险至关重要。

OKX 挂单类型概览

OKX 主要提供以下几种类型的挂单,满足不同交易策略和风险管理需求:

  • 限价单 (Limit Order): 这是最常用的挂单类型之一。交易者预先设定一个期望的买入或卖出价格,以及交易数量。当市场价格达到或优于设定的限价时,订单会被执行。限价单的核心优势在于可以控制交易成本,确保不会以高于(买入)或低于(卖出)预期的价格成交。然而,限价单的缺点在于,如果市场价格始终未达到设定的价格,订单将不会被执行,从而错过交易机会。限价单适用于对价格敏感,且不急于成交的交易者。
  • 市价单 (Market Order): 市价单以当前市场上可获得的最佳价格立即执行。与限价单相反,市价单不指定价格,而是以速度为优先。这种订单类型保证了快速成交,尤其是在市场波动剧烈时,确保交易能够迅速完成。但是,市价单的价格不确定性较高,实际成交价格可能会与下单时的预期价格存在偏差,尤其是在交易深度不足的市场中。市价单适合需要快速成交,对价格不太敏感的交易者。
  • 止损单 (Stop Order): 止损单是一种条件单,其核心目的是限制潜在的亏损。交易者预设一个止损价格,当市场价格达到或突破该价格时,止损单会被触发,并转化为市价单,然后以当前市场最优价格执行。止损单的主要用途包括:在持有仓位时,设定最大可承受的亏损;在空仓时,捕捉突破行情。止损单并非完全保证成交价格,极端行情下,可能出现滑点,导致成交价格与止损价格存在较大差异。
  • 止盈止损单 (OCO Order): OCO (One-Cancels-the-Other) 订单是一种组合订单,同时包含一个限价单(用于止盈)和一个止损单(用于止损)。当其中一个订单被完全或部分执行时,另一个订单会自动取消。OCO 订单是风险管理和盈利锁定工具,允许交易者预先设定理想的盈利目标和可接受的最大亏损。OCO 订单在简化交易操作的同时,也提供了更高的灵活性和控制力。需要注意的是,和止损单类似,止盈止损单也可能受到滑点的影响。
  • 高级限价单 (Advanced Limit Order): OKX 提供的高级限价单,是对传统限价单功能的扩展,旨在满足更复杂的交易需求。主要包括 "只做 Maker (Post Only)"、"立即成交或取消 (IOC)" 和 "全部成交或取消 (FOK)" 等选项,这些选项进一步细化了限价单的执行逻辑。
    • 只做 Maker (Post Only): 确保订单只作为 Maker (挂单方) 存在于订单簿中。如果提交的订单会立即与已存在的订单成交,则该订单会被自动取消。这种类型的订单主要用于享受 Maker 手续费优惠,因为交易所通常会对提供流动性的 Maker 给予较低的手续费。Post Only 策略适合希望降低交易成本,并且不急于立即成交的交易者。
    • 立即成交或取消 (IOC): 允许订单立即成交部分数量,订单中未成交的部分会被立即取消。IOC 订单的目标是在尽可能短的时间内成交尽可能多的数量,适用于对成交效率有较高要求的交易者。例如,在快速变化的市场中,交易者可能希望立即成交一部分订单,以避免错过机会。
    • 全部成交或取消 (FOK): 要求订单必须全部成交,否则整个订单会被立即取消。FOK 订单追求的是完全成交,适用于对成交数量有严格要求的交易者。如果市场深度不足,无法一次性满足订单的全部数量,则订单会被取消,避免了部分成交的情况。FOK 策略通常用于执行大型交易,确保一次性完成交易目标。

策略分析:不同场景下的挂单选择

在复杂多变的市场环境下,根据不同的市场状况和交易目标,制定并选择合适的挂单策略是交易成功的关键要素。挂单类型繁多,每种类型都有其独特的适用场景,交易者需要深入理解其特性,才能在实战中灵活运用。

  • 震荡行情:精准捕捉区间波动

    震荡行情的显著特征是价格在特定区间内呈现规律性波动,缺乏明确的上涨或下跌趋势。在这种市场环境中,交易者可以利用限价买单和限价卖单,分别在支撑位和阻力位附近挂单。当价格回落至支撑位时,限价买单将被执行,随后价格反弹至阻力位时,限价卖单将被执行,从而实现低买高卖,捕捉价格波动带来的利润。为了有效控制风险,可以配合使用 OCO (One-Cancels-the-Other) 订单,同步设置止盈和止损价格,一旦其中一个订单被触发,另一个订单将自动取消,确保盈利的同时限制潜在亏损。

  • 趋势行情:动态跟踪趋势,保护利润

    趋势行情表现为市场价格沿着某一方向持续上涨或下跌,形成明显的趋势。在趋势行情中,交易者应侧重于顺应趋势方向进行交易。止损单在趋势跟踪中扮演着至关重要的角色,它可以帮助交易者保护已获得的利润或有效限制潜在损失。例如,在上涨趋势中,可以将止损单设置为跟踪止损,即止损价格随着市场价格的上涨而动态调整,始终保持在略低于当前市场价格的位置。一旦市场价格开始回调,止损单将被触发,从而锁定部分利润,避免利润回吐。同样,在下跌趋势中,止损单可以用于限制潜在损失,防止亏损进一步扩大。

  • 突破行情:果断捕捉突破机会

    突破行情是指市场价格突破了重要的支撑位或阻力位,预示着新的趋势可能即将开始。交易者可以通过设置止损买入单 (Buy Stop Order) 和止损卖出单 (Sell Stop Order) 来提前布局,捕捉突破机会。止损买入单通常设置在阻力位上方,一旦市场价格向上突破阻力位,该订单将被触发,自动买入,从而及时跟进上涨趋势。止损卖出单则设置在支撑位下方,一旦市场价格向下突破支撑位,该订单将被触发,自动卖出,从而及时跟进下跌趋势。需要注意的是,突破行情存在假突破的风险,交易者应结合其他技术指标和市场分析,谨慎判断,降低交易风险。

  • 流动性不足的市场:精细控制交易价格

    在流动性不足的市场中,交易深度较浅,买卖盘之间的价差较大,如果使用市价单进行交易,很可能面临滑点问题,即实际成交价格与预期价格存在显著偏差,导致交易成本增加。为了避免滑点,交易者应尽量使用限价单进行交易,明确指定期望的成交价格,从而更好地控制交易成本。同时,需要注意订单可能无法及时成交,特别是当市场价格波动剧烈时。为了进一步降低交易成本,可以使用 "只做 Maker" (Post Only) 的高级限价单,确保订单只以挂单 (Maker) 的形式进入市场,从而享受更低的交易手续费。如果订单会立即与市场上的现有订单成交 (Taker),则该订单将被自动取消。

  • 高频交易:极致追求速度和效率

    高频交易 (HFT) 是一种利用计算机程序在极短时间内执行大量交易的交易策略。对于高频交易者而言,交易速度至关重要,毫秒级别的延迟都可能导致利润损失。OKX 等交易所通常提供 API (Application Programming Interface) 接口,允许交易者编写程序化交易策略,通过 API 接口以极快的速度提交、修改和取消订单,实现自动化交易。高级限价单中的 IOC (Immediate-or-Cancel) 和 FOK (Fill-or-Kill) 选项可以满足高频交易者对订单执行的特定需求。IOC 订单要求订单必须立即全部或部分成交,任何未成交的部分将被立即取消。FOK 订单要求订单必须立即全部成交,否则整个订单将被取消。这些选项可以帮助高频交易者更精确地控制订单执行,提高交易效率。

风险管理:挂单策略的注意事项

尽管挂单策略在加密货币交易中能显著提升效率,但有效的风险管理至关重要。合理运用挂单策略能优化交易执行,但忽视潜在风险可能导致意外损失。以下为使用挂单策略时需要特别关注的风险点,以及相应的应对措施:

  • 滑点风险: 市价单和止损单都受到滑点的影响,尤其是在市场波动剧烈或流动性不足时。滑点是指实际成交价格与预期价格之间的差异。在波动性较高或交易量较小的交易对中,滑点发生的概率更高。

    应对措施:

    • 选择高流动性交易对: 流动性好的交易对通常滑点较低,因为市场深度足够,即使有大额交易,价格也不会出现大幅波动。
    • 避免在剧烈波动时交易: 重大新闻事件发布前后,市场波动往往加剧,此时应谨慎使用市价单和止损单,或适当放宽止损范围。
    • 限价止损单: 考虑使用限价止损单代替市价止损单。限价止损单在触发止损价时,会以限定价格或更优价格成交,但可能存在无法成交的风险。

  • 挂单失败风险: 限价单和止盈止损单存在无法完全成交或根本无法成交的风险。如果市场价格始终未触及设定的挂单价格,订单将不会被执行。交易所可能存在最小成交量限制,若订单量低于该限制,也可能导致挂单失败。

    应对措施:

    • 合理设置挂单价格: 仔细分析市场趋势,结合技术指标,设置更合理且易于成交的价格。
    • 适当调整挂单价格: 若长时间未成交,可根据市场变化,适当调整挂单价格,以提高成交概率。
    • 拆分订单: 将大额订单拆分为多个小额订单,分批挂单,可以降低因市场快速波动而导致全部订单无法成交的风险。

  • 黑天鹅事件风险: 极端市场情况下,如发生重大突发事件(例如监管政策变化、交易所安全漏洞等),市场价格可能出现断崖式下跌或暴涨,导致止损单失效,或订单成交价格远低于预期,产生巨大损失。

    应对措施:

    • 分散投资: 将资金分散投资于不同的加密货币,降低单一资产风险。
    • 合理仓位控制: 每次交易投入的资金比例不宜过高,避免因一次极端事件导致全部资金损失。
    • 定期重新评估风险: 关注市场动态,及时调整投资策略和风险控制措施。
    • 考虑使用期权等衍生品对冲风险: 通过购买看跌期权等方式,对冲价格下跌风险。

  • API 风险: 使用 API 交易能实现自动化交易,但需要特别注意API的安全性和稳定性。代码漏洞可能导致资金被盗,不合理的限速设置可能导致订单延迟执行或无法执行。

    应对措施:

    • 代码安全审计: 定期对API交易代码进行安全审计,及时修复潜在漏洞。
    • 使用安全的API密钥管理方法: 不要将API密钥硬编码在代码中,可以使用环境变量或配置文件等方式进行管理。
    • 合理设置API限速: 根据交易所的API限速要求,合理设置API请求频率,避免触发风控机制。
    • 监控API运行状态: 实时监控API的运行状态,及时发现并解决问题。
    • 使用受信的API交易平台: 选择信誉良好、安全性高的API交易平台。

具体案例分析:基于 OKX 平台

假设交易者希望在 BTC/USDT 交易对中进行交易,利用OKX提供的交易工具和策略。

  • 案例一:震荡行情中的网格交易
  • 交易者预计 BTC/USDT 将在 60000 USDT 到 65000 USDT 之间横盘整理。网格交易策略适用于这种波动较小的行情。交易者可以在 OKX 平台上设置网格交易机器人,设定价格区间为 60000 USDT 至 65000 USDT,网格间距设置为 100 USDT。这意味着系统会在该区间内自动创建多个以100 USDT为间隔的限价买单和卖单。当市场价格下跌至某个网格的买单价格时,该买单成交,买入 BTC。随后,当价格上涨至上方某个网格的卖单价格时,该卖单成交,卖出 BTC,从而赚取网格之间的差价利润。通过参数优化,例如调整网格数量和间距,可以更好地适应市场波动,提高收益率。需要关注交易手续费对盈利的影响,并适时调整策略。

  • 案例二:突破行情中的趋势跟踪
  • 交易者判断 BTC/USDT 有较大可能向上突破 65000 USDT 的关键阻力位,进入上升趋势。为了抓住突破后的上涨机会,交易者可以在 OKX 平台设置一个条件单,具体为在 65500 USDT 处设置一个止损买入单。当 BTC/USDT 价格突破 65000 USDT 并进一步上涨至 65500 USDT 时,该止损买入单将被触发,自动买入 BTC。为了锁定利润并防止价格回调造成的损失,交易者可以同时设置一个跟踪止损单。跟踪止损单会随着市场价格的上涨自动调整止损价格,始终保持与市场价格一定的距离。例如,设置跟踪止损距离为 2%,当 BTC/USDT 价格上涨时,止损价格也会随之升高,而当价格下跌超过 2% 时,则会触发止损卖出,从而实现盈利最大化,同时有效控制风险。需要注意的是,在剧烈波动的市场中,跟踪止损可能会被频繁触发,导致不必要的交易。

  • 案例三:避免吃单,降低手续费
  • 交易者希望在 OKX 平台买入 BTC/USDT,但为了尽可能降低交易成本,希望以 Maker 身份成交,享受更低的手续费。Maker 订单是指挂单等待成交的订单,不会立即与市场上的现有订单成交,从而为交易所提供流动性。交易者可以使用 OKX 高级限价单中的 "只做 Maker" (Post Only) 选项。启用此选项后,如果交易者设置的买单价格会立即与市场上的卖单成交(即成为 Taker 订单),该订单将不会被执行,而是会被系统自动取消。为了确保订单能够以 Maker 身份成交,交易者需要稍微降低买单的价格,使其低于当前市场上的最低卖单价格,等待其他交易者主动来成交。通过这种方式,交易者可以避免成为 Taker,从而享受 Maker 手续费的优惠。需要注意的是,使用 "只做 Maker" 选项可能会导致订单无法及时成交,特别是在快速变动的市场中。

总结:

熟练掌握OKX交易所提供的各类挂单策略,并依据瞬息万变的市场动态灵活调整,对于提升交易效率和优化风险管理至关重要。不同的挂单类型,例如限价单、市价单、高级限价单(冰山委托、时间加权平均价格策略TWAP、跟踪委托等),各自适用于不同的交易场景和策略目标。

深入理解每种挂单策略的特性是成功应用的前提。例如,限价单允许交易者指定买入或卖出的价格,确保交易以期望的价格执行或不执行;市价单则以当前最佳可用价格立即成交,追求速度而非价格最优;而高级限价单则提供了更为复杂的交易逻辑,帮助交易者在不暴露全部交易意图的情况下完成大额交易,或是在波动市场中捕捉有利时机。

成功的交易者会根据自身的风险承受能力、市场预期以及具体的交易目标,选择并组合不同的挂单策略。例如,在预期价格将突破关键阻力位时,可以使用条件限价单来提前布局;在需要快速完成交易时,则可以使用市价单。持续监控市场变化,并根据实际情况调整挂单策略,也是提高交易成功率的关键。只有精通各种挂单策略并灵活运用,才能在加密货币市场中获得竞争优势。